**Action item (P2):** The ParcelPing webhook flooded downstream consumers during the Kestrel Logistics outage because our retry logic had no jitter and a way-too-short backoff floor. Everything retried in lockstep and we basically DDoS'd ourselves for forty minutes. Owner is the Delivery Events squad. Fix is to add jittered exponential backoff plus a per-endpoint concurrency cap, and document the values so nobody guesses them again. For reference, the retry and backoff constants we're standardizing on are below.

tuning constants:
QUOTAS = {
    "druwyn": 5,
    "holix": 5,
    "zorath": 5,
    "holwyn": 10,
}

Facilities ticket — Night shift, Brindlecote Campus. Twenty-two interns from the Fennhollow programme arrive tomorrow at 08:00. Please unlock seminar rooms B2 and B3 by 06:30, set chairs to classroom layout, and confirm the water coolers on level one are refilled. Leave the loading bay clear for their equipment van. Overnight access to the prep corridor requires the pass code below.

badge for bajop-yawep: bdg-NNHEW-6

# Divestiture: Quillson Packaging Unit (Managers Only)

Status: advanced negotiations with Arvane Holdings. Unit: Quillson Packaging, including the Dresmoor site and associated contracts. Headcount transfers under standard terms. Expected close: end of Q3. Diligence is complete; outstanding items are warranty caps and pension treatment. Board approval required at the next session. The confidential note on proceeds allocation and forward plans appears below.

board note of bawep-tajef: Queniusek Systems plans to raise the Quenvan list price by 53.1 percent in March. The pricing group signed off on a budget of $176.4 million for Project Drueth. The renewal with Casionix Partners closes at $142.5 million a year, 8.3 percent below the last contract. Project Fraax slips by six weeks because of the tooling delay.

Handover: Quillmark consent banner rollout, phase 2. Banner is live in three regions; opt-out persistence fixed Tuesday. Remaining: audit log retention review and the Fenwick locale strings. Nothing blocked. For your security review, the current production configuration of the consent service is as follows.

settings of fafog-haduf:
ZORIX_PIN=4648
ZORIX_METRICS_HOST=metrics.zorix.paliqsys.corp
ZORIX_LOG_LEVEL=info
ZORIX_TENANT=druix